STARKE — A Florida man convicted of raping and killing his neighbor decades ago was put to death Tuesday evening in a record 15th execution in Florida this year.
Norman Mearle Grim Jr. was pronounced dead at 6:15 p.m. following a three-drug injection at Florida State Prison near Starke, the office of Republican Gov. Ron DeSantis said.
When asked if he had a final statement just before the drugs began flowing, Grim replied, “No sir,” said Alex Lanfranconi, a spokesman for the governor. Lanfranconi added that there were no complications as the death sentence was carried out.
